Command that is currently unavailable—command with “?” added
Invalid parameter—command with current value
Action command with unnecessary parameter—action command
Action command that is unavailable—action command
The following simplified example shows how the projector typically responds to a request to
change the active input source. Note that the three latter notifications are delayed.
Room controller commands
In the following tables, if the parameter listing for a particular command is “None,” that
command requires no parameter. Some commands are valid only when the projector is turned
on, STAT=1. Some commands are available only when specific input sources are active.
Request:
*RSRC=4<CR>
Notification:
*RSRC=4<CR><LF>
(acknowledges request)
*SRC=0<CR><LF>
(projector is attempting to acquire source 4, and in the interim
has no valid source)
*SRC=4<CR><LF>
(source 4 is now active)
*BRT=60<CR><LF>
(brightness has been modified for source 4)
*CSPC=?<CR><LF>
(color space is not supported for this input)
Source function
Command
Parameters
Description
SRC
?
Queries the current active input source: 0=no active
source,1=VGA-in, 3=composite video, 4=S-video, 8=DVI.
RSRC
1, 3, 4, 8, ?
Attempts to use the specified source as the active input source,
or queries the last source requested: 1=VGA-in, 3=composite
video, 4=S-video, 8=DVI.
NXT
None
Switches to the next input source.
AUTO
0, 1, ?
Sets or queries automatic searching inputs for signal: 0=no
searching, 1=searching.
